How plot 2d of more than 3 function and substitute the number in each function separate parameter?

2 vues (au cours des 30 derniers jours)
How i can plot 2D of thus function and in each function susbtitute the value m seperatly with different color ? like this example
y1=real(((-0.385e1 * tanh(-x - 0.310e1) - 0.385e1 * coth(-x - 0.310e1)) ^ (0.1e1 / m / 0.2e1)) * exp(i * (0.431e1 * t - 0.282e1)));
y2=real(((-0.385e1 * tanh(-x - 0.310e1) - 0.385e1 * coth(-x - 0.310e1)) ^ (0.1e1 / m / 0.2e1)) * exp(i * (0.431e1 * t - 0.282e1)));
y3=real(((-0.385e1 * tanh(-x - 0.310e1) - 0.385e1 * coth(-x - 0.310e1)) ^ (0.1e1 / m / 0.2e1)) * exp(i * (0.431e1 * t - 0.282e1)));
y4=real(((-0.385e1 * tanh(-x - 0.310e1) - 0.385e1 * coth(-x - 0.310e1)) ^ (0.1e1 / m / 0.2e1)) * exp(i * (0.431e1 * t - 0.282e1)));
y5=real(((-0.385e1 * tanh(-x - 0.310e1) - 0.385e1 * coth(-x - 0.310e1)) ^ (0.1e1 / m / 0.2e1)) * exp(i * (0.431e1 * t - 0.282e1)));
  5 commentaires
salim
salim le 8 Fév 2025
Modifié(e) : salim le 8 Fév 2025
@Walter Roberson i don't delete this question ! and other too why i do that i am not sick

Connectez-vous pour commenter.

Réponse acceptée

Torsten
Torsten le 7 Fév 2025
y=@(x,t,m)real(((-0.385e1 .* tanh(-x - 0.310e1) - 0.385e1 * coth(-x - 0.310e1)) .^ (0.1e1 ./ m ./ 0.2e1)) .* exp(i * (0.431e1 * t - 0.282e1)));
x = (0:0.1:2).';
t = 1;
m = 0.5:0.5:3;
plot(x,y(x,t,m))
xlabel('x')
ylabel('y')
legend('m=0.5','m=1','m=1.5','m=2','m=2.5','m=3')
  2 commentaires
salim
salim le 7 Fév 2025
Modifié(e) : salim le 7 Fév 2025
@Torsten can i make the line a little bit begger and make them like a dash - - - - i can't apply for all of them in one graph i need add option and make it save for all future graph
Torsten
Torsten le 7 Fév 2025
All the plot options are listed in the section "Input Arguments" under
Read about "LineSpec" and "LineWidth".

Connectez-vous pour commenter.

Plus de réponses (0)

Catégories

En savoir plus sur Creating, Deleting, and Querying Graphics Objects dans Help Center et File Exchange

Tags

Produits


Version

R2021b

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!

Translated by